From patchwork Thu Dec 21 06:45:30 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Hangbin Liu X-Patchwork-Id: 851776 X-Patchwork-Delegate: davem@davemloft.net Return-Path: X-Original-To: patchwork-incoming@ozlabs.org Delivered-To: patchwork-incoming@ozlabs.org Authentication-Results: ozlabs.org; spf=none (mailfrom) smtp.mailfrom=vger.kernel.org (client-ip=209.132.180.67; helo=vger.kernel.org; envelope-from=netdev-owner@vger.kernel.org; receiver=) Authentication-Results: ozlabs.org; dkim=pass (2048-bit key; unprotected) header.d=gmail.com header.i=@gmail.com header.b="RUms/dsw"; dkim-atps=neutral Received: from vger.kernel.org (vger.kernel.org [209.132.180.67]) by ozlabs.org (Postfix) with ESMTP id 3z2Mbf6CdMz9s81 for ; Thu, 21 Dec 2017 17:45:50 +1100 (AEDT)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1751424AbdLUGps (ORCPT ); Thu, 21 Dec 2017 01:45:48 -0500 Received: from mail-pg0-f50.google.com ([74.125.83.50]:46393 "EHLO mail-pg0-f50.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1750891AbdLUGpr (ORCPT ); Thu, 21 Dec 2017 01:45:47 -0500 Received: by mail-pg0-f50.google.com with SMTP id b11so12905498pgu.13 for ; Wed, 20 Dec 2017 22:45:46 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id; bh=hk/cG3PurzC+qXsQJ++HT5nUGOuzFCjU6wfUgx/aH0Y=; b=RUms/dswDfRi6NDIqFgo7+7tuyTT1hV8avvEc5BiM6ay5zXjd/UbpFW7ub+CIPedlz wg2IF5hsMDNU5u1/PwBUkALvi7Bf6U/FPKgM2f/y5ObAlPMmbbVxTTEeZT5I6kkfXu3Y HVwIJ3fZoPi/YTL3zhezApdwqVsx+rhXLXlU4rECqnjU8AVELfuiKQyLhI3tKoD0Onvb O+6g6BTwzFfrUmi9vCEuAmbqlcqkVu87zTkIG6lVaAPTQ4VXkboAX4t5aQL6/O9qrvcz Y9hWXtwmGizOaV4thEve7Bmtdki6I2CxmXI9a815CBl3Fl4X9EvWqcFrSx8b+Wwiv8OC J5aQ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id; bh=hk/cG3PurzC+qXsQJ++HT5nUGOuzFCjU6wfUgx/aH0Y=; b=mMlfG7h5O8V6BeFOsvV8ni0HGppgQbAXDV1EEI8mi1PSk8I4Ftd/DRnuK/IDyG26mC bKPIwhbQkWiYNQi7F3sNeUYjj0ip7As+Lrpl7OSiE+Fy5V/8gSzwOYzupY4L8M5OWFkA szt+itmtncipsIesZ/KxOsOEDHkePrYvLx2hM2eOuno47YXarbNORNeLU2OkO+Ug6GaC JGWHvEXqPHkUBgl0hJ060+TuzX6whb+0fL6uYfVUOzNmXB37/JVP/2BYZwqrxdPE3YnE BHTOxwDDAQ18E1IMBQWiYhTtJdPQbGwe4blTKgIkT36nraawjIMpV3QhZyTXIdkAOFH6 4wHQ== X-Gm-Message-State: AKGB3mJh19mIlTdu6HbzBLBNlVVGs47UNzltHxZ+4LLTkM8gCq8eV83b 9zX9JkAMUhZd71I3NirS7WhquVd6 X-Google-Smtp-Source: ACJfBosW2fj2f7FDrtMDosdwmq2bcNUEJqVARjvHpXO6dFPCgIWkm8DYEv46LwBierHIaIuZGjXyYA== X-Received: by 10.99.94.71 with SMTP id s68mr8736166pgb.242.1513838746503; Wed, 20 Dec 2017 22:45:46 -0800 (PST) Received: from leo.usersys.redhat.com ([209.132.188.80]) by smtp.gmail.com with ESMTPSA id r5sm32776082pgq.25.2017.12.20.22.45.43 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Wed, 20 Dec 2017 22:45:45 -0800 (PST) From: Hangbin Liu To: netdev@vger.kernel.org Cc: James Chapman , "David S. Miller" , Hangbin Liu Subject: [PATCH net] l2tp: fix missing print session offset info Date: Thu, 21 Dec 2017 14:45:30 +0800 Message-Id: <1513838730-14033-1-git-send-email-liuhangbin@gmail.com> X-Mailer: git-send-email 2.5.5 Sender: netdev-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: netdev@vger.kernel.org Fixes: 309795f4bec ("l2tp: Add netlink control API for L2TP") Reported-by: Jianlin Shi Signed-off-by: Hangbin Liu --- net/l2tp/l2tp_netlink.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/net/l2tp/l2tp_netlink.c b/net/l2tp/l2tp_netlink.c index a1f24fb..36378b4 100644 --- a/net/l2tp/l2tp_netlink.c +++ b/net/l2tp/l2tp_netlink.c @@ -761,6 +761,8 @@ static int l2tp_nl_session_send(struct sk_buff *skb, u32 portid, u32 seq, int fl if ((session->ifname[0] && nla_put_string(skb, L2TP_ATTR_IFNAME, session->ifname)) || + (session->offset && + nla_put_u16(skb, L2TP_ATTR_OFFSET, session->offset) || (session->cookie_len && nla_put(skb, L2TP_ATTR_COOKIE, session->cookie_len, &session->cookie[0])) ||